akwizgran
116ee97056
Merge branch '1980-catch-security-exceptions-from-connectivity-manager' into 'master'
...
Catch SecurityExceptions from all ConnectivityManager calls
Closes #1980
See merge request briar/briar!1634
2022-04-20 14:51:57 +00:00
Torsten Grote
78938f1ac6
Merge branch '2280-check-lifecycle-before-recreating-removable-drive-tasks' into 'master'
...
Check lifecycle state before recreating removable drive tasks
Closes #2280
See merge request briar/briar!1629
2022-04-20 13:37:24 +00:00
akwizgran
afff66eaff
Don't assume that non-null WifiInfo means we're connected to wifi.
2022-04-20 12:42:35 +01:00
akwizgran
a8624cd507
Guess connectivity when ConnectivityManager is broken.
2022-04-19 11:27:40 +01:00
akwizgran
e7fc37d81e
Catch SecurityExceptions from all ConnectivityManager calls.
...
This issue occurs on Android 11 and no fix is expected. When the issue occurs, Tor connectivity and outgoing LAN connectivity will be broken until the app is restarted.
2022-04-19 11:03:08 +01:00
Torsten Grote
7bd220f18d
Merge branch 'clear-glide-cache-under-more-circumstances' into 'master'
...
Clear the Glide cache in response to a wider range of warnings
See merge request briar/briar!1633
2022-04-18 16:46:31 +00:00
Torsten Grote
174ca3cfb8
Merge branch '2214-catch-activity-not-found-exception-when-saving-image' into 'master'
...
Catch ActivityNotFoundException when saving image
Closes #2214
See merge request briar/briar!1627
2022-04-18 12:44:20 +00:00
akwizgran
961af66c8e
Use new onSaveImageError() method for readability.
2022-04-18 13:33:09 +01:00
Torsten Grote
a86ea454d0
Merge branch '2143-rethrow-security-exceptions-when-opening-images' into 'master'
...
Rethrow SecurityExceptions when opening images
Closes #2143
See merge request briar/briar!1626
2022-04-18 12:12:20 +00:00
Torsten Grote
a7877bf7ee
Merge branch '2273-rethrow-security-exceptions-for-removable-drives' into 'master'
...
Rethrow SecurityExceptions when opening files on removable drives
Closes #2273
See merge request briar/briar!1625
2022-04-18 12:11:42 +00:00
Torsten Grote
62ae0f745b
Merge branch '2306-task-scheduler-zero-delay' into 'master'
...
Fixe race condition in AndroidTaskScheduler
Closes #2306
See merge request briar/briar!1624
2022-04-18 11:57:34 +00:00
Torsten Grote
f83abbe63d
Merge branch '2305-increase-tor-connection-timeout' into 'master'
...
Increase Tor connection timeout to 2 minutes
Closes #2305
See merge request briar/briar!1623
2022-04-18 11:53:57 +00:00
Torsten Grote
e0b6b8435d
Merge branch 'update-introduction-onboarding-text' into 'master'
...
Update introduction onboarding text
See merge request briar/briar!1631
2022-04-18 11:49:41 +00:00
akwizgran
d3c7832245
Update introduction onboarding text.
...
The old text caused some confusion in user testing because contacts can now add each other remotely.
2022-04-18 11:34:22 +01:00
akwizgran
a043e8b1cf
Check lifecycle state before recreating removable drive tasks.
2022-04-17 12:28:26 +01:00
akwizgran
bc013296f6
Catch ActivityNotFoundException when saving image.
2022-04-17 11:59:00 +01:00
akwizgran
c1fabcd46b
Rethrow SecurityExceptions when opening images.
2022-04-17 11:51:49 +01:00
akwizgran
3c08e86822
Rethrow SecurityExceptions when opening files on removable drives.
2022-04-17 11:36:16 +01:00
akwizgran
de2c9670d5
Clear the Glide cache in response to a wider range of warnings.
2022-04-17 10:50:59 +01:00
akwizgran
9632754274
Ensure task is added to queue before queue is checked.
2022-04-16 19:32:51 +01:00
akwizgran
b275a0ffff
Increase Tor connection timeout to 2 minutes.
2022-04-16 16:07:03 +01:00
akwizgran
74a3f54d28
Merge branch '2172-mailbox-status-ui' into 'master'
...
Implement status UI for mailbox connection
Closes #2172
See merge request briar/briar!1617
2022-04-14 12:46:28 +00:00
Torsten Grote
edcb234b93
Show OfflineFragment when TorPlugin becomes inactive in mailbox flow
2022-04-12 10:10:09 -03:00
Torsten Grote
dae00c7e4e
Show different mailbox status in UI
...
and show failure status after unsuccessful attempt
2022-04-12 10:01:43 -03:00
Torsten Grote
29b16c4d74
Re-use OfflineFragment when offline in mailbox status screen
2022-04-12 09:35:39 -03:00
Torsten Grote
40d58a9359
Prevent memory leak and crash when refreshing MailboxStatusFragment
2022-04-07 11:00:41 -03:00
Torsten Grote
60a1a4d2d1
Make MailboxManager#checkConnection() blocking and let the UI manage the executor
2022-04-07 10:44:24 -03:00
Torsten Grote
238aeb3abd
Merge branch 'extend-timeout-for-pre-release-tests' into 'master'
...
Extend timeout for pre-release tests
See merge request briar/briar!1618
2022-04-04 11:13:50 +00:00
akwizgran
62c16fad09
Merge branch '2191-reset-retransmission-times-when-contacts-mailbox-props-change' into 'master'
...
Reset retransmission times when contact's mailbox props change
Closes #2191
See merge request briar/briar!1619
2022-04-04 10:19:02 +00:00
Daniel Lublin
68e57bda0d
Reset retransmission times when contact's mailbox props change
2022-04-04 12:01:19 +02:00
akwizgran
0df73dbf0a
Extend timeout for pre-release tests.
2022-04-02 08:16:34 +01:00
Torsten Grote
5b648cbd35
Add connection check button to Mailbox status UI
...
and update the last connection timestamp accordingly
2022-04-01 13:55:11 -03:00
Torsten Grote
5e7891d78a
Add checkConnection() to MailboxManager
2022-04-01 13:55:11 -03:00
akwizgran
d5e17c8201
Bump version numbers for 1.4.6 release.
release-1.4.6
beta-1.4.6
alpha-1.4.6
2022-04-01 17:05:12 +01:00
Torsten Grote
d572ae71e7
Merge branch 'more-non-default-bridges' into 'master'
...
Vanilla bridges
See merge request briar/briar!1611
2022-04-01 16:02:58 +00:00
akwizgran
2e9d9dac84
Update translations.
2022-04-01 16:45:59 +01:00
akwizgran
573817c4c9
Map el to el-GR for Play Store metadata.
2022-04-01 16:44:07 +01:00
Torsten Grote
4f00f39d3f
Merge branch 'initialise-mailbox-eager-singletons' into 'master'
...
Initialise mailbox eager singletons at startup
See merge request briar/briar!1616
2022-04-01 15:30:47 +00:00
akwizgran
c7d3628ecb
Update Play Store metadata.
2022-04-01 16:22:46 +01:00
akwizgran
b198bef5f8
Initialise mailbox eager singletons at startup.
2022-04-01 16:02:12 +01:00
Torsten Grote
cff94009a1
Merge branch 'tor-0.4.5' into 'master'
...
Upgrade to Tor 0.4.5.12-1 and obfs4proxy 0.0.12
See merge request briar/briar!1608
2022-04-01 14:00:50 +00:00
Torsten Grote
44f9f0bbc5
Merge branch 'more-tor-events' into 'master'
...
Log more Tor events and react to CIRCUIT_NOT_ESTABLISHED
See merge request briar/briar!1605
2022-04-01 13:22:09 +00:00
akwizgran
5fdb43ce9b
Merge branch '2192-reset-retransmission-times-when-pairing-mailbox' into 'master'
...
Reset retransmission times when pairing (new) mailbox
Closes #2192
See merge request briar/briar!1615
2022-04-01 13:08:47 +00:00
Daniel Lublin
725d11d960
Extend test
2022-04-01 14:56:05 +02:00
Daniel Lublin
7cf2c2faa7
Reset retransmission times when pairing (new) mailbox
2022-04-01 14:56:05 +02:00
akwizgran
4b3c26feb6
Merge branch 'fix_openOutputStream' into 'master'
...
Fix usage of ContentResolver.openOutputStream()
See merge request briar/briar!1607
2022-04-01 12:36:50 +00:00
akwizgran
2fbeb29195
Merge branch 'simplify-and-get-rid-of-contactmanager' into 'master'
...
Simplify and get rid of injected contactmanager
See merge request briar/briar!1614
2022-04-01 11:18:43 +00:00
akwizgran
5892fba237
Merge branch '2267-broadcast-event-when-recording-own-mailbox-connection-status' into 'master'
...
Broadcast event when recording connection status of own mailbox
Closes #2267
See merge request briar/briar!1613
2022-04-01 11:17:47 +00:00
akwizgran
cc9f04980a
Merge branch 'fix-exception-logging' into 'master'
...
Don't warn about background exceptions unless one was thrown
See merge request briar/briar!1610
2022-04-01 11:15:33 +00:00
Daniel Lublin
44fb2a5c59
Use db directly, get rid of injected ContactManager
2022-04-01 10:31:52 +02:00